Optical Clear Adhesive Laminator for LCD Bonding
The integration of LCD displays into modern devices increasingly relies on precise Optical Clear Adhesive lamination processes. A dedicated Optically Clear Adhesive bonding machine ensures even glue distribution and enhanced screen clarity. These machines are critically important for preventing traps and separation, which can drastically impact device quality. Contemporary Optically Clear Adhesive application units often incorporate computerized alignment systems and accurate temperature regulation, leading to increased production rate and a reduction in rejects. In addition, selecting lcd bonding machine the right laminator should consider the area of the panel being adhered and the specific type of Optically Clear Adhesive being used.
Automatic LCD Laminating Systems
The increasing demand for high-quality panel assemblies has spurred significant development in manufacturing processes. Automatic LCD bonding systems represent a essential step in this progression. These systems precisely dispense optical adhesives between the LCD display and the cover glass, providing uniform depth and minimizing air cavities. They offer substantial advantages over hand processes, including improved precision, lower workforce outlays, and higher production.
COF Bonding & Panel Bonding Equipment
The demand for miniaturized and high-performance displays has spurred significant advancements in COF bonding and Panel bonding equipment. Modern manufacturing processes necessitate precise alignment and reliable bonding of the flex circuit film to the LCD, crucial for signal transmission and overall display functionality. Precision LCD Lamination and Process
Achieving optimal visual clarity in modern LCD screens necessitates critical attention to the adhesive method. This isn't merely a issue of placing an adhesive; rather, it's a complex challenge demanding accurate values across multiple stages. Uneven force, variable temperature, or inadequate substance selection can lead to noticeable defects, including peeling, cavities, and distorted image performance. In addition, the option of the appropriate adhesive – considering factors such as optical value, thickness, and climatic resistance – is crucial for long-term longevity and performance.
